//! Module for the definition of a parse result
use super::ast::Ast;
use super::ast::AstImpl;
use super::errors::ParseErrors;
use super::symbols::Symbol;
use super::text::Text;
use super::tokens::TokenRepository;
use super::tokens::TokenRepositoryImpl;
/// Represents the output of a parser
pub struct ParseResult {
/// The table of grammar terminals
terminals: &'static [Symbol],
/// The table of grammar variables
variables: &'static [Symbol],
/// The table of grammar virtuals
virtuals: &'static [Symbol],
/// The input text
text: Text,
/// The errors found in the input
errors: ParseErrors,
/// The table of matched tokens
tokens: TokenRepositoryImpl,
/// The produced AST
ast: AstImpl
}
impl<'a> ParseResult {
/// Initialize a new parse result
pub fn new(
terminals: &'static [Symbol],
variables: &'static [Symbol],
virtuals: &'static [Symbol],
text: Text
) -> ParseResult {
ParseResult {
terminals,
variables,
virtuals,
text,
errors: ParseErrors::new(),
tokens: TokenRepositoryImpl::new(),
ast: AstImpl::new()
}
}
/// Gets the grammar terminals
pub fn get_terminals(&self) -> &'static [Symbol] {
self.terminals
}
/// Gets the grammar variables
pub fn get_variables(&self) -> &'static [Symbol] {
self.variables
}
/// Gets the grammar virtuals
pub fn get_virtuals(&self) -> &'static [Symbol] {
self.virtuals
}
/// Gets the input text for this result
pub fn get_input(&self) -> &Text {
&self.text
}
/// Gets whether this result denotes a successful parsing
pub fn is_success(&self) -> bool {
self.ast.has_root()
}
/// Gets the collection of errors
pub fn get_errors(&self) -> &ParseErrors {
&self.errors
}
/// Gets the token repository associated with this result
pub fn get_tokens(&self) -> TokenRepository {
TokenRepository::new(&self.terminals, &self.text, &self.tokens)
}
/// Gets the resulting AST
pub fn get_ast(&self) -> Ast {
Ast::new(
TokenRepository::new(&self.terminals, &self.text, &self.tokens),
self.variables,
self.virtuals,
&self.ast
)
}
/// Gets the mutable data required for parsing
pub fn get_parsing_data(&mut self) -> (TokenRepository, &mut ParseErrors, Ast) {
(
TokenRepository::new_mut(&self.terminals, &self.text, &mut self.tokens),
&mut self.errors,
Ast::new_mut(self.variables, self.virtuals, &mut self.ast)
)
}
}
